FORTRESS FILLOMINO:
• Divide the grid into orthogonally connected regions and fill each cell with a number (not necessarily single-digit) showing the number of cells in the region to which it belongs;
• Each region must be either strictly larger than all of its orthogonal neighbours or strictly smaller than all of its orthogonal neighbours.
SLINGSHOTS:
• For any given arrow, the number in the cell connected to its tail also appears N cells away in the direction of its tip, where N is the number in the arrow's cell.
• For example, if r1c1 was 5 and r2c1 was 3, then r1c6 would be a 3.
